1.1. Field of application
The control system was developed so that the different technical equipment installed
in conservatories and buildings could be centrally controlled. The control units offer
the highest measure of flexibility with regard to connections, allowing settings to be
optimally and individually adjusted to the circumstances on site. Please use this oper-
ational guide to adjust the automatic functions to your requirements and enable com-
fortable manual operation.
1.1.1. Delivery scope
• Central control and operations unit
WS1 Color: With integrated indoor sensor. With 1, 2, 3 or 4 drive outputs for
230 V motors or without drive outputs, depending on model.
WS1 Color-PF: With integrated indoor sensor. With 1, 2, 3 or 4 potential-free
drive outputs, depending on model.
WS1000 Color: With 4, 6, 8 or 10 drive outputs for 230 V motors, depending on
model.
WS1000 Color-PF: With 4, 6, 8 or 10 potential-free drive outputs, depending on
model.
